Transaction 6023bf21b792081c117998be232184f32f08282e47d53b23e7e02bf98f0e6258
1 Input
1 Output
-
6023bf21b792081c117998be232184f32f08282e47d53b23e7e02bf98f0e6258:0
- value
- 82420912
- script pubkey
- OP_0 OP_PUSHBYTES_32 e9413667ebdcbaeb6f3a609eb04e5ffbf2226c18dbbd51f672723ab9a4b7ec86
- address
- bc1qa9qnveltmjawkme6vz0tqnjll0ezymqcmw74ranjwgatnf9hajrqtay08r